Reverse Power Protection

Updated: 2026-08-16

Overview

A reverse power monitoring protection device is a critical component in power generation systems, designed to detect and prevent reverse power flow. This condition occurs when power flows back into the generator, potentially causing severe damage. The device monitors the power direction and disconnects the generator if reverse flow is detected. These devices are widely used in industries such as marine, power plants, and backup power systems. Their primary role is to ensure the safe and efficient operation of generators by preventing mechanical stress and electrical faults caused by reverse power conditions.

Structure and Working Principle

The reverse power monitoring protection device typically consists of sensors, a control unit, and a relay mechanism. The sensors measure the direction and magnitude of power flow, while the control unit processes this data to determine if reverse power conditions exist. When reverse power flow is detected, the control unit sends a signal to the relay, which disconnects the generator from the load. This rapid response prevents damage to the generator and connected equipment. Advanced models may include features like adjustable sensitivity, time delays, and communication interfaces for integration with broader control systems.

Key Features

Modern reverse power monitoring protection devices offer several key features to enhance reliability and usability. High sensitivity ensures early detection of reverse power conditions, while adjustable settings allow customization for specific applications. Robust construction ensures durability in harsh environments, such as marine or industrial settings. Some devices also include real-time monitoring and logging capabilities, enabling operators to track performance and diagnose issues. Compatibility with various generator types and compliance with international standards further enhance their versatility.

Application Areas

Reverse power monitoring protection devices are essential in various industries where generator safety is paramount. In marine applications, they protect shipboard generators from reverse power flow during parallel operations. Power plants use these devices to safeguard backup generators and ensure grid stability. Industrial facilities with on-site generation also rely on these devices to prevent equipment damage and downtime. Their role in maintaining operational efficiency and safety makes them indispensable in critical power systems.

Maintenance and Precautions

Regular maintenance is crucial to ensure the reliable operation of reverse power monitoring protection devices. Calibration should be performed periodically to maintain accuracy, and sensors should be inspected for damage or contamination. Proper installation is also vital, with attention to wiring and grounding to prevent false alarms or malfunctions. Operators should adhere to manufacturer guidelines for setup and operation, and any deviations should be addressed promptly to avoid compromising system integrity.

B2B Procurement Guide

When procuring reverse power monitoring protection devices, B2B buyers should consider several factors to ensure optimal performance and value. Compatibility with existing generator systems is paramount, as is the device's sensitivity range and response time. Certification to international standards, such as IEC or IEEE, indicates compliance with industry best practices. Buyers should also evaluate the supplier's reputation, after-sales support, and availability of spare parts. Comparing prices and features across multiple vendors can help identify the best fit for specific operational needs.
